### Insulation Properties

One of the main features of polystyrene EPS 100 is its excellent insulation properties. Due to its closed-cell structure, expanded polystyrene offers superior thermal insulation, which helps in keeping the temperature consistent in buildings, transportation containers, and other applications. This makes it an ideal choice for use in construction projects, as it helps to reduce energy consumption and lowers heating and cooling costs.

### Versatility in Applications

The versatility of polystyrene EPS 100 makes it a popular choice for a wide range of applications. In the packaging industry, expanded polystyrene is used to protect fragile items during transportation, thanks to its cushioning properties. It is also used in the food industry for packaging perishable goods, as it helps to maintain the product’s freshness and prevents spoilage.

In the construction industry, polystyrene EPS 100 is commonly used for insulating roofs, walls, and floors, as it helps to improve the energy efficiency of buildings. The material is also used in road construction as lightweight fill material and in flotation devices due to its buoyancy properties. Additionally, expanded polystyrene is used in the manufacture of decorative moldings, architectural shapes, and props due to its ease of shaping and cutting.
